1933 Swedish Ice Hockey Championship
The 1933 Swedish Ice Hockey Championship was the 12th season of the Swedish Ice Hockey Championship, the national championship of Sweden. Hammarby IF won the championship. Swedish Ice Hockey Champions
The Swedish ice hockey champions ( sv, Svenska mästare i ishockey) is a title awarded annually to the winning playoff team of the top-tier ice hockey league in Sweden, which currently is the Swedish Hockey League (SHL) since 1975. It was first awarded to IK Göta in 1922, the championship's inaugural year. The championship's present SHL format did not take into effect until the league was originally formed for the 1975–76 season under the name of Elitserien. A team who wins the Swedish Championship is awarded the Le Mat Trophy. Djurgårdens IF holds the most titles in history with 16 titles, but Färjestad BK, who's played all 45 seasons of the current top-tier league, is the most successful SHL team with ten championship titles. The most recent Swedish Champions are also Färjestad BK, who won their tenth title in club history in 2022.
